Product Description

AISHi PZ Series Conductive Polymer Aluminum Electrolytic Capacitors

The AISHi PZ series offers conductive polymer aluminum electrolytic capacitors designed for high-performance applications. These capacitors feature low ESR and are suitable for a wide range of industrial uses, including system boards, display cards, small chargers, and intelligent TVs. They are RoHS compliant and lead-free, ensuring environmental responsibility.

Technical Specifications

Item Specification Details
Category Code E Electrolytic Capacitor
Type Code PZ Conductive Polymer
Endurance +105C 2,000 hours
Key Feature Low ESR
Recommended Applications System Board, Display Card, Small Charger, Intelligent TV
Temperature Range -55C to +105C
Rated Working Voltage Range 6.3Vdc to 100Vdc
Nominal Capacitance Range 4.7F to 5600F
Capacitance Tolerance 20% (M)
DC Leakage Current 0.2CV or 500A, whichever is greater (at 20C, 120Hz) (Where I: leakage current (A), C: Nominal capacitance (F), V: Rated voltage (V))
Dissipation Factor (tan) See table for values (at 20C, 120Hz)
ESR See table for values (100kHz to 300kHz, 20C)
Temperature Characteristics (Impedance Ratio at 100kHz) Z(+105C)/Z(+20C) 1.25
Z(-55C)/Z(+20C) 1.25
Endurance Test Requirements Capacitance Change: 20% of initial value
D.F. (tan): 150% of initial specified value
ESR: 150% of initial specified value
Leakage Current: Initial specified value
(After 2,000 hours at 105C)
Humidity Test Requirements Capacitors shall meet Endurance characteristics (After 2,000 hours at 60C, 90%-95% RH without voltage)
Surge Test Requirements Capacitance Change: 20% of initial value
D.F. (tan): 150% of initial specified value
ESR: 150% of initial specified value
Leakage Current: Initial specified value
(After 1,000 cycles of surge voltage application)

Soldering Recommendations

Flow Soldering (Radial Lead Type)

  • Preheating: 130 20C, 30-90 sec.
  • Cooling: (1-3C)/sec. (max.)
  • Soldering Temp.: Approx. 260C, < 1 sec.

Reflow Soldering (Polymer SMD Type)

  • Recommended Reflow Profile: See diagram.
  • Preheating: 150C to 180C, Within 90 sec.
  • Peak Temperature (T1): 230C to 260C (max. 10 sec.)
  • Time above 200C (t1): Max. 50 sec.
  • Time above T.C. (t2): Max. 150 sec.

Reflow Soldering (Liquid SMD Type)

  • Case size: 6.3-10mm:
    • Preheat: 100C to 200C, Max. 180 sec.
    • Peak Temp. (T1): 230C to 250C (max. 5 sec.)
    • Duration over 200C (t): Max. 90 sec.
    • Duration over T.C.: Max. 40 sec.
  • Case size: 12.5-18mm:
    • Preheat: 100C to 180C, Max. 150 sec.
    • Peak Temp. (T1): 230C to 240C (max. 5 sec.)
    • Duration over 200C (t): Max. 60 sec.
    • Duration over T.C.: Max. 30 sec.
